Frequently Asked Questions

When and where will the GSM graduation ceremony be held?
Spring 2013: Graduation will be on Saturday, April 20th at 11 a.m. at the Irving Arts Center (Irving, Texas). The ceremony usually lasts between 1-2 hours.

What time do I need to arrive? Why?
Spring 2013: Please report to Irving Arts Center no later than 10 a.m. for check-in and line-up. (More details will be forthcoming.)

At line-up, you will be issued a card with your name and a number and hometown. The number on your card refers to the order in which you will walk in the processional and the order in which you will be called to receive your diploma. It is important that you stay in numerical order during the line-up and procession.

What do I need to bring with me?
Wear your cap, cap tassel, gown and stole (if you have chosen to purchase a stole). Bring but do not wear your hood-- you will carry it with you and be "hooded" on stage. Please leave other non-essential items with family or friends.

Will I receive my diploma at the graduation ceremony?
Diplomas are given out at graduation unless you have a hold on your account.

How will I receive my diploma if I am not attending the graduation ceremony?
If you are not attending graduation, you will need to make arrangements to have your diploma mailed to you by contacting Laura Rudolph in the Registrar's Office (lrudolph@udallas.edu). You will need to provide your name, student ID number, graduation term, and mailing address. You may not receive your diploma until after they are conferred at commencement.
